LD31 - FuFuFuel!

Finally! First entry ever! First time "finishing" a playable game from scratch in such a short time (less than 12 hours, dammit chores!!). Link

The original intention was to build a survival defense kind of game, with simple graphics but focus on strategy and macromanagement. I guess I was overambitious, though. Most of the planned features never made it into the game (complex targets, level-up weapons, etc.) It's way past bedtime and it's freaking Monday tomorrow...

Enjoy the game, post your scores in the comments! (Didn't manage to implement the high scores table, awww.) I'm sure I'll find time to build on the game post-jam. (After rating the games, of course!)

That feeling of being a thief

I must have been really lucky to stumble upon this gem. The Very Organized Thief puts you in the shoes of a thief tasked with "borrowing" some items from a residential house. In fact, you've even made a checklist.

So you want to be a transport tycoon

Recently I've been playing Simutrans.

Simutrans is a sandbox game where you build a transportation network to deliver goods and passengers to their destinations.
